Was wandering round local hardware shop while Mrs Robo was getting some keys cut and had a look at the electrical section. Looked at the helpful labeling like 2.5mm² T&E "for use on ring mains" etc., when I saw some red & black singles marked "not for mains voltage" had a look at the side of the reels, it was 6491X, looks like I've been using the wrong cable for the last 35 years :D
 
Probably meaning that because we are not supposed to be installing red and black anymore , he can only sell it for other uses rather than its former use , we can re connect red and black but not install it ,,

Correction I suppose you could use the black as a phase if you needed it ,,,

Once UKIP get in we'll be going back to Red White and Blue.

We were just on the transition to red, yellow and blue when I started my apprenticeship.
 
That's interesting, I've only known RYB (70's apprentice) what did they use before?


Red White and Blue were the phase colours before the white was changed to yellow. Can't for the life of me remember the reason for the change, but i'm sure someone here will know!! lol!!
